The Wanderers Align. The classical planets —the seven astronomical bodies that can be seen without a telescope, and appear to move in relation to the stars—are coming into an eye-catching alignment. 6 planets in the planetary alignment on June 3, 2024. The next planetary alignment will take place on June 3, 2024. In the early morning, six planets — Mercury, Mars, Jupiter, Saturn, Uranus, and Neptune — will align in the sky.
